ArticleZip > Get Aria Expanded Value

Get Aria Expanded Value

Welcome, tech enthusiasts! If you're diving into the realm of software engineering and seeking to enhance your coding skills, you've come to the right place. Today, we're delving into the concept of "Aria Expanded Value" in the world of software development.

"Aria Expanded Value" refers to a practical technique utilized in web development to improve accessibility for users with disabilities, particularly those who rely on screen readers to navigate websites. By incorporating Aria attributes into your code, you can provide additional information to assistive technologies and make your web content more inclusive and user-friendly.

So, how can you implement Aria Expanded Value in your projects? Let's walk through the steps to ensure your websites are accessible to all users.

Firstly, identify the elements on your webpage that require Aria attributes. These could include buttons, form inputs, or any interactive elements that need to be properly interpreted by assistive technologies.

Next, consider which Aria attributes are most suitable for your specific use case. The "aria-expanded" attribute, in particular, is commonly used to indicate the current state of collapsible elements such as menus or accordions. This attribute can have a value of "true" or "false" to signify whether the element is expanded or collapsed.

To implement the "aria-expanded" attribute, you simply need to add it to the corresponding HTML element and update its value dynamically based on user interactions. For example, if a user expands a collapsible menu, you would set the "aria-expanded" attribute to "true" to inform assistive technologies of the change in state.

It's essential to update the Aria attributes dynamically using JavaScript to ensure that screen readers can provide real-time feedback to users with disabilities. By incorporating Aria Expanded Value into your code, you contribute to a more inclusive web experience for all users.

Remember to test the accessibility of your website using screen readers or accessibility tools to verify that the Aria attributes are functioning as intended. User testing is crucial to identify any potential issues and ensure that your web content is truly accessible to everyone.

In conclusion, by incorporating Aria Expanded Value into your web development projects, you demonstrate a commitment to inclusivity and accessibility. Enhancing the user experience for individuals with disabilities should be a priority in modern web design, and Aria attributes offer a straightforward way to achieve this goal.

So, go ahead and start implementing Aria Expanded Value in your coding projects today. Make your websites more accessible and user-friendly for all visitors. Happy coding, and remember that a more inclusive web benefits everyone!